资源简介:
提供甘肃省天水市道路停车数据,方便交通管理部门及停车运营单位查询甘肃省天水市内的停车情况,分析道路停车的各路段泊位周转率、日平均停车时长分布等,进行停车运营的管理。当车辆驶入或驶出停车位时,安装在此停车位上的地磁车位检测器检测到磁场变化,判断有车还是无车,将判断后的数据通过NB-IoT实时传输到云平台, 平台解析数据并根据数据库中存储的车位设备关系表,找到对应所属的车位编号以及路段信息。平台每小时按照省份、城市、路段的层次从数据库检索,并按照如下规则做数据统计:统计最近一小时内,该路段下所有泊位地磁上报的有车总数据条数作为【停车次数】;统计当前时刻该路段下有车的泊位数量,作为【占用泊位】数量;统计当前时刻该路段下无车的泊位数量,作为【空闲泊位】数量;空闲泊位+占用泊位作为【泊位总数】;占用泊位/泊位总数作为【泊位占用率】;停车次数/泊位总数作为【周转率】;每个泊位停车时长总和作为【总停车时长】;总停车时长/停车次数 作为【平均停车时长】; 最后将省份、城市、路段、日期、统计时间、泊位总数、空闲泊位、占用泊位、泊位占用率、停车次数、周转率、总停车时长(分钟)、平均停车时长(分钟)存储到数据库中供后续查询。

This dataset provides road parking data for Tianshui City, Gansu Province, to enable traffic management departments and parking operation entities to query on-site parking conditions in Tianshui City, Gansu Province, analyze indicators such as the turnover rate of parking spaces per road segment and the distribution of daily average parking durations, and support parking operation management. When a vehicle enters or exits a parking space, the geomagnetic parking space detector mounted on the target parking spot detects magnetic field variations to determine the presence or absence of a vehicle, and transmits the resulting judgment data to the cloud platform in real time via NB-IoT. The platform parses the received data and retrieves the corresponding parking space ID and road segment information using the parking space-device relationship table stored in the database. The platform conducts data retrieval from the database on an hourly basis following the hierarchical structure of province → city → road segment, and performs statistical calculations according to the following rules: 1. Calculate [Parking Times] as the total number of reported vehicle-present records from all geomagnetic detectors under the target road segment within the last hour; 2. Calculate [Occupied Parking Spaces] as the number of parking spaces occupied by vehicles at the current moment under the target road segment; 3. Calculate [Idle Parking Spaces] as the number of unoccupied parking spaces at the current moment under the target road segment; 4. [Total Parking Spaces] is defined as the sum of Idle Parking Spaces and Occupied Parking Spaces; 5. [Parking Space Occupancy Rate] is computed as the ratio of Occupied Parking Spaces to Total Parking Spaces; 6. [Turnover Rate] is computed as the ratio of Parking Times to Total Parking Spaces; 7. Calculate [Total Parking Duration] as the cumulative sum of parking durations across all parking spaces under the target road segment; 8. [Average Parking Duration] is computed as the ratio of Total Parking Duration to Parking Times; Finally, the platform stores the following indicators into the database for subsequent query and analysis: province, city, road segment, statistics timestamp, Total Parking Spaces, Idle Parking Spaces, Occupied Parking Spaces, Parking Space Occupancy Rate, Parking Times, Turnover Rate, Total Parking Duration (in minutes), and Average Parking Duration (in minutes).
